Comment edit

The AfD on this was no consensus, and it looks like that may have been the correct result, as it looks like a decent bit of sourcing is available. However, I've cut a lot of stuff down that appeared to be pretty promotional. We don't need more than one fair-use image in the article, there certainly is no need for more than a single link to the "official site", and web forums are never a reliable source. We also don't need a "list of features", unless independent sources have reported on some feature as really setting this thing apart. I'd strongly encourage everyone here to read the guidelines on editing an article where you may have a conflict of interest, as well as the policy on neutrality.
